Development and Distribution of an Educational Synthetic Aperture Radar(eSAR) Processor

교육용 합성구경레이더 프로세서(eSAR Processor)의 개발과 공개

  • Lee, Hoon-Yol (Department of Geophysics, Kangwon National University)
  • Published : 2005.04.01


I have developed a processor for synthetic aperture radar (SAR) raw data compression using range-doppler algorithm for educational purpose. The program realized a generic SAR focusing algorithm so that it can deal with any SAR system if the specification is known. It can run efficiently on a low-cost computer by selecting minimum size out of a whole dataset, and can produce intermediate images during the process. Especially, the program is designed for educational purpose in such a way that Doppler centroid and azimuth ambiguity can be determined graphically by the user. By distributing the source code and the algorithm to public, I intend to maximize the educational effect on understanding and utilizing SAR data. This paper introduces the principle of SAR focusing algorithm embedded on the eSAR processor and shows an example of data processing using ERS-1 raw data.

합성구경레이더(Synthetic Aperture Radar) 원시 자료(raw data)를 range-Doppler 알고리듬을 이용하여 처리하는 교육용 공개 프로그램을 개발하였다 이 프로그램은 SAR 시스템에 따라 자료처리에 필요한 변수를 자유롭게 조절함으로써, 특정 SAR 시스템에 치우치지 않고 다양한 자료를 처리할 수 있도록 일반화된 알고리듬을 구현하였다. 저가 사양의 컴퓨터에서도 최소 단위의 영상을 선택적으로 처리할 수 있고 자료 처리 중간 단계별로 영상 출력이 가능하기 때문에, 프로그램 작동 상태와 SAR의 원리를 직접 확인할 수 있도록 하였다. 특히 Doppler 변수를 자료 처리 중간 단계의 영상을 보고 직접 구할 수 있도록 고안하여 교육적 효과를 높였다. 또한 자료 처리 알고리듬과 원시프로그램을 모두 공개함으로써, SAR 시스템 원리를 이해하고 응용하는데 도움을 주고자 한다. 이 논문에서는 프로그램의 원리와 작동 환경을 소개하고, ERS-1 원시 자료를 이용한 자료 처리의 예를 보였다.



  1. 국가과학기술위원회, 2000. 우주개발중장기기본계획 수정안
  2. Curlander, J. C. and R. N. McDonough, 1991. Synthetic Aperture Radar Systems and Signal Processing, John Wiley & Sons, Inc
  3. Press, W. H., 1993. Numerical Recipes in C: The Art of Scientific Computing, 2nd ed., Cambridge
  4. Brigham, E. O., 1988. The Fast Fourier Transform and its Applications, Prentice-Hall, Inc